METODE ID2D1Geometry::ComputeArea(constD2D1_MATRIX_3X2_F&,FLOAT,FLOAT*) (d2d1.h)
Menghitung area geometri setelah diubah oleh matriks yang ditentukan dan diratakan menggunakan toleransi yang ditentukan.
Sintaks
HRESULT ComputeArea(
const D2D1_MATRIX_3X2_F & worldTransform,
FLOAT flatteningTolerance,
FLOAT *area
);
Parameter
worldTransform
Jenis: [in] const D2D1_MATRIX_3X2_F &
Transformasi yang akan diterapkan ke geometri ini sebelum menghitung areanya.
flatteningTolerance
Jenis: [in] FLOAT
Kesalahan maksimum yang diizinkan saat membuat perkiraan poligonal geometri. Tidak ada titik dalam representasi poligonal yang akan menyimpang dari geometri asli dengan lebih dari toleransi perataan. Nilai yang lebih kecil menghasilkan hasil yang lebih akurat tetapi menyebabkan eksekusi yang lebih lambat.
area
Jenis: [out] FLOAT*
Ketika metode ini kembali, berisi penunjuk ke area geometri ini yang ditransformasi dan diratakan. Anda harus mengalokasikan penyimpanan untuk parameter ini.
Mengembalikan nilai
Jenis: HRESULT
Jika metode ini berhasil, metode akan mengembalikan S_OK. Jika tidak, kode kesalahan HRESULT akan dikembalikan.
Persyaratan
Persyaratan | Nilai |
---|---|
Klien minimum yang didukung | Windows 7, Windows Vista dengan SP2 dan Pembaruan Platform untuk Windows Vista [aplikasi desktop | Aplikasi UWP] |
Server minimum yang didukung | Windows Server 2008 R2, Windows Server 2008 dengan SP2 dan Pembaruan Platform untuk Windows Server 2008 [aplikasi desktop | Aplikasi UWP] |
Target Platform | Windows |
Header | d2d1.h |
Pustaka | D2d1.lib |
DLL | D2d1.dll |
Lihat juga
Saran dan Komentar
https://aka.ms/ContentUserFeedback.
Segera hadir: Sepanjang tahun 2024 kami akan menghentikan penggunaan GitHub Issues sebagai mekanisme umpan balik untuk konten dan menggantinya dengan sistem umpan balik baru. Untuk mengetahui informasi selengkapnya, lihat:Kirim dan lihat umpan balik untuk